As nouns, office is a hypernym of US Government Printing Office; that is, office is a word with a broader meaning than US Government Printing Office:
  • US Government Printing Office: an agency of the legislative branch that provides printing and binding services for Congress and the departments and establishments of the federal government
  • office: an administrative unit of government
Other hypernyms of US Government Printing Office include agency, authority, bureau, federal agency, government agency.
